The primary reason for mesothelioma is asbestos exposure, which normally occurs in occupational settings. Those most at danger include building employees, shipyard employees, and those associated with asbestos mining and production. In addition to submitting a lawsuit, there are other avenues for getting payment for mesothelioma patients:

Asbestos Trust Funds: Many companies that produced or used asbestos have established trust funds to compensate victims. Affected individuals can submit claims versus these funds.

VA Claims: Veterans exposed to asbestos throughout military service may receive benefits and payment from the Department of Veterans Affairs.

Employees' Compensation: If the exposure happened in the office, applying for employees' settlement benefits might be an option, depending upon the state laws.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. The length of time do I have to file a mesothelioma lawsuit?
Each state has a statute of constraints relating to accident claims. Normally, it ranges from one to 3 years from the date of medical diagnosis or discovery of the disease. It is vital to speak with an attorney for particular timeframes.
2. How much payment can I receive?
Settlement differs extensively based on case specifics, consisting of the intensity of the health problem, exposure scenarios, and the accountable celebrations. Settlements can vary from numerous thousands to countless dollars in many cases.
3. What documents do I require for a mesothelioma lawsuit?
Secret documents consist of medical records, employment history, proof of asbestos exposure, and financial records demonstrating lost wages and costs sustained due to the disease.
4. Can I pursue a claim on behalf of a deceased loved one?
Yes, if a liked one has passed away due to [Mesothelioma Lawsuit Legal Assistance](https://hedgedoc.info.uqam.ca/s/HI0cA6Bp9), household members can submit a wrongful death lawsuit against responsible parties, seeking settlement for their loss.
5. What if I was diagnosed numerous years after exposure?
You might still submit a match, as lots of states have actually provisions for delayed start signs. An attorney concentrating on mesothelioma claims can assist you through this procedure.
